Cheers (1982)
I haven't seen all of the episodes of this one, and in fact came to the show much later, in my early twenties, in the form of reruns. But I've seen quite a few, enough to appreciate the paradigm shift between Shelley Long and Christie Alley. I always preferred Shelley Long on the show, but Christie had her moments as well. And of course, this show gave rise to a spin-off that is also immensely popular, Frasier. A classic series well worth tracking down.

This one I did grow up with, and even though I don't tend to gravitate to the horror genre (I'm more of a science fiction/fantasy fan), this one is worth a gander if you can find it. I have the first two seasons, but the third and final season eludes me. The basic premise is a niece and nephew inherit their uncle's shop of cursed antiques and must work to retrieve them from the people their uncle sold them to. It has some great episodes, but also some rather dull or poor ones, like most shows.

Obviously I'm a huge sci-fi fan, at least as far as tv shows go. I tend to lean more towards fantasy in novels and reading. I haven't yet seen a great epic fantasy tv series, though some good movies have been made. This one hinges on Dr. Sam Beckett caught in a time travel experiment, always seeking a way to finally return back home to his own life and time period. As he "leaps through time," he is tasked with "putting right what once went wrong." It's a very quirky show with some profound moments, right along side humorous and light-hearted ones. It was also the first show I came to appreciate Scott Bakula on.
